首页 > 科技 >

💻博图TIA中ModbusRTU_CRC校验程序的实现 😊

发布时间:2025-03-19 01:32:47来源:

在工业自动化领域,Modbus协议因其简单易用的特点被广泛采用。而Modbus RTU模式下的CRC校验,则是确保数据传输准确性的关键步骤之一。本文将介绍如何在西门子博图(TIA Portal)软件中实现Modbus RTU CRC校验功能,帮助大家轻松应对复杂的数据通信场景。

首先,我们需要明确CRC校验的基本原理:它通过对数据帧进行特定算法计算,生成一个固定长度的校验码,用于验证数据完整性。在TIA Portal中,可以通过编写梯形图逻辑或使用功能块来实现这一功能。例如,利用现有的Modbus库函数结合自定义CRC算法,可以快速搭建起完整的校验流程。

接下来,在实际操作时,需注意以下几点:一是正确配置串口参数,包括波特率、数据位、停止位和奇偶校验等;二是确保数据帧格式符合Modbus RTU规范;三是调试过程中仔细检查CRC计算结果是否与预期一致。通过以上步骤,即可完成高效的CRC校验程序开发。

总之,掌握Modbus RTU CRC校验技巧不仅能够提升项目稳定性,还能为后续扩展提供更多可能性。💪

工业自动化 TIAPortal ModbusRTU CRC校验

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。